# --- Migration settings (Larkspur billing service) ---
# Zero-downtime rule: expand, backfill, contract. Never drop or rename
# a column in the same release that stops writing it. Migrations run
# via the `ledgerctl migrate` wrapper, which takes an advisory lock so
# concurrent deploys can't race. Backfills must be chunked (5k rows)
# and resumable. Do not point migrations at the pooled endpoint; the
# pooler drops long transactions. Use the direct migration endpoint
# via the connection string below.

primary connection of yagep-kahip = redis://giliel_svc:zYiKsLL2PLpfPL@db-348f.xolmarsys.corp:5432/fenwyn

## Deployment

Digestline runs as a single worker per region. Deploy via the Fernwall pipeline; no manual steps. Digest batching windows are region-local — do not share cron state across regions or you'll double-send. Rollbacks are safe mid-window; the scheduler checkpoints after each batch. Verify the scheduler picks up the environment before promoting. The worker must boot with the following configuration.

deployment values, kajep-kageg:
[praix]
host = praix.paliqcorp.corp
user = praix_svc
database = praix_prod

Subject: Cut-over complete — Fenwick breaker now fronting the Tallgrass API

Team,

The cut-over finished last night without incident. All traffic to the upstream Tallgrass API now passes through the Fenwick circuit breaker, and the old retry shim has been fully retired. Please do not tune thresholds ad hoc; propose changes via review. For the record, the breaker went live with these configuration values:

service settings:
[silwyn]
host = silwyn.crelvogrid.internal
user = silwyn_svc
database = silwyn_prod